What are some common challenges faced by Data Analytics Interns who relocate for their internship, and how can these be managed?

Relocating for a Data Analytics Internship often presents challenges such as adjusting to a new city, building a professional network from scratch, and adapting to the company's culture and data tools. Interns may find the initial weeks overwhelming as they balance settling in and meeting project expectations. Proactively reaching out to teammates, attending company events, and seeking mentorship can help ease the transition. Many organizations also offer onboarding sessions and resources to support relocated interns, so taking advantage of these can make the move smoother and more rewarding.

What are Data Analytics Intern Relocation programs?

Data Analytics Intern Relocation programs are initiatives by employers to support interns who need to move to a new city or country for a data analytics internship. These programs may provide financial assistance, housing support, or guidance on moving logistics. The goal is to make it easier for interns to transition smoothly and focus on their internship experience. Depending on the employer, relocation packages can vary greatly, so it’s important to ask about available support during the application process.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Data Analytics Int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Data Analytics Intern, you need a strong grasp of statistics, data analysis, and foundational programming skills, often supported by coursework in data science, statistics, or a related field. Familiarity with tools such as Excel, SQL, Python or R, and data visualization platforms like Tableau or Power BI is typically expected. Critical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ication make candidates stand out by enabling them to interpret and present data insights clearly. These skills and qualities are crucial for extracting actionable insights from complex data and supporting informed business decisions.

Business Analyst Intern
DKS Associates, an employee-owned company and a leader in transportation planning and engineering, is seeking a Business Analyst Intern for our downtown Portland office. We are looking for an energetic, organized, self-motivated candidate with strong data analysis and AI skills to support our corporate marketing and business development team. This internship will focus on improving our proposal development processes and enhancing market intelligence efforts through data analysis and emerging AI technologies. The position provides an opportunity to gain real-world experience by applying skills learned through academic coursework in a professional consulting environment.
The successful candidate will gain exposure to the business and consulting side of transportation engineering and planning while developing valuable experience in business analysis, marketing, and AI-enabled workflow optimization. This position will be hourly, non-exempt, working up to 40 hours per week over a 12 week period. This position will be hybrid, working in the office Tuesday, Wednesday, and Thursday.
What will you be doing?
  • Coordinating and organizing proposal development resources, including past proposals, project descriptions, staff resumes, project imagery, and related materials
  • Assisting with the setup, testing, and evaluation of AI-assisted proposal development tools and workflows
  • Supporting the setup and testing of AI-driven market intelligence tools to identify industry trends and project opportunities
  • Analyzing customer experience and feedback data to identify trends and develop actionable insights
  • Supporting business development and marketing initiatives through data analysis and process improvement efforts
What are we looking for?
  • Preferred - Currently enrolled at an accredited university pursuing studies in business, data science, marketing, or a related field
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to follow written and verbal instructions and work effectively both independently and within a team environment
  • Excellent attention to detail and strong organizational and analytical skills
  • Familiarity with AI technologies, prompt engineering, and data analysis tools
  • Ability to translate data into clear insights and compelling narratives
  • Self-motivated, organized, and capable of managing multiple tasks with minimal supervision
